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_024901.5(DENND2D):c.1097A>G(p.Lys366Arg)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,326 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 17/23 in silico tools predict a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
DENND2D (HGNC:26192): (DENN domain containing 2D) Enables guanyl-nucleotide exchange factor activity. Predicted to be involved in regulation of catalytic activity. Located in cytosol and nucleoplasm.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sApr 27, 2023The c.1097A>G (p.K366R) alteration is located in exon 10 (coding exon 10) of the DENND2D gene. This alteration results from a A to G substitution at nucleotide position 1097, causing the lysine (K) at amino acid position 366 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
